tail wastegate port question
for the side port, which is supposed to get its boost source from before the throttle plate, what happens if you run it to the intake mani after the throttle plate?

Re: tail wastegate port question (model x)
It's been discussed before, but basically if you put the vaccum line from the turbo (before the intercooler) you're wastegate will likely open a few psi early because of the pressure drop across the intercooler, etc. You can take a line from the manifold to the w/g and that'll compensate for the intercooler's pressure drop.
It's not big deal, and it's not like your car will blow up or anything if you do this. Alot of people go from the manifold, myself included.
